Sintered Bronze Bushes are high-performance, self-lubricating components designed to provide smooth, low-friction, and maintenance-free operation in a wide range of industrial applications. These bushes are manufactured using powder metallurgy technology, where bronze powder is compressed and sintered to form a porous structure.
The porous structure is impregnated with lubricating oil, which is gradually released during operation, ensuring continuous lubrication without the need for external oil or grease. This makes sintered bronze bushes ideal for applications requiring quiet, efficient, and long-lasting performance.
Engineered for precision and reliability, sintered bronze bushes offer excellent wear resistance, consistent operation, and extended service life, even under continuous working conditions.

Q1. What is a sintered bronze bush?
It is a bush made using powdered bronze, designed with a porous structure that holds lubricating oil.
Q2. Do sintered bronze bushes require lubrication?
No, they are pre-lubricated and provide continuous lubrication during operation.
Q3. Where are sintered bronze bushes used?
They are widely used in motors, appliances, and light machinery applications.

| Technical Data | ||
|---|---|---|
| Performance Index | Data | |
| Max Load Capacity | Static load | 35N/mm² |
| Dynamic load | 18N/mm² | |
| Max Sliding Speed | Dry friction | 2.0m/s |
| Oil lubrication | 5.0m/s | |
| Max PV Value Limit | Dry friction | 1.2N/mm² · m/s |
| Oil lubrication | 2.8N/mm² · m/s | |
| Friction Coefficient | Dry friction | 0.08~0.18 |
| Oil lubrication | 0.03~0.10 | |
| Working Temperature | -40℃~+120℃ | |
| Thermal Conductivity | 58W/m · k | |
| Coefficient of Thermal Expansion | 18X10⁻⁶/K | |
